Dot
n.-
A marriage portion; dowry.
n.
- A small point or spot, made with a pen or other pointed instrument; a speck, or small mark.
-
Anything small and like a speck comparatively; a small portion or specimen;
as, a .dot of a child
v. t.
-
To mark with dots or small spots;
as, to .dot a line - To mark or diversify with small detached objects; as, a landscape dotted with cottages.
v. i.
-
To make dots or specks.
prop. n.
-
The United States Department of Transportation.
The Department of Transportation promulgates standards for the strength of shipping containers, and this abgreviation is often seen on cardboard boxes.
